Right now we’re looking for a Clerical Support Associate to work on 8 West Medicine
Location: Humber River Hospital – Wilson
Reporting to: Manager, 8 East and 8 West
Hours of work: Available to work rotating shifts (Days, Evenings, Nights & Weekends)
Hourly rate:25.993 – 26.904
Employee Group: Teamsters
Job Responsibilities:
Responsible for clerical support including patient registration and discharge, maintenance of patient records, order entry and statistics.
Responsible for customer service including scheduling appointments, answering patient inquiries, telephone inquiries, greeting patients and visitors in a courteous manner.
Communicates with bed allocation and other departments to arrange patient placement.
Communicates with other departments and service areas.
Other duties as assigned.
Qualifications:
High school graduate or equivalent
Completion of secretarial and medical terminology courses an asset
Completion of a Community College Medical Secretary Diploma an asset
A good working knowledge of basic related medical terminology
Minimum 1 year full time equivalent recent clerical experience required, and preferably in a health care setting.
Good keyboarding skills, with minimum typing speed of 40 WPM.
Computer proficiency including Microsoft Office Suite
Strong interpersonal skills, both oral and written
MEDITECH computer experience an asset
Good organizational and problem solving skills required, including an ability to prioritize a varied and busy workload. Demonstrated ability to cope with tight deadlines, frequent interruptions and emergency situations
Ability to work independently with minimal supervision in a team environment
Knowledge of a second language an asset
Demonstrated customer service skills.
A positive attendance record and discipline free record is a requirement
Applicants may be required to successfully complete full administrative testing, to include typing speed and MS Office.
